I just installed my new B&M yesterday. All ive done is taken it for one ride and Its deffinity a lot different than stock. As I was installing I wondered what exactly needs to break in after the install. I heard that it wont have so much resistance after it breaks in. All the moving parts are the same as with stock. Also Ive been listening to the tranny a little closer and noticed that i have to retime my shifts to avoid my syncros kicking in. I think ill adjust fine and assuming it really does break in I think ill have a great time with it.

^^ the linkages aren't in the same place as with stock..THAT is what needs to be broken in. and rest assured, it will be. after i installed my b&m it took about a week or two to get a smoother shift feel from it.
